Initially I didn't like that they got rid of the silent mode. Now that I get used to the priority mode, I actually like it a lot. I just schedule the priority mode between 12am - 8am daily in the way that only alarm and my starred contacts can wake me up. Everything else still come through notification on screen, just no sound, no vibrate and no flashing light. During meeting I just manually set to none. It's a brilliant idea by google.
